This minimalist Moroccan Beni Ourain rug presents a refined interpretation of traditional North African textile art. The piece is defined by its understated geometric pattern, woven into a plush, natural cream ground that exemplifies the enduring appeal of Berber craftsmanship.
Hand-knotted from pure wool, the rug features a subtle, linear design that creates a sense of architectural structure within the soft pile. The natural, undyed wool offers a warm, organic texture, while the traditional fringed edges complete the authentic aesthetic. The dimensions are approximately 300 centimetres in length and 200 centimetres in width, providing substantial coverage for a variety of spaces.
The rug is in perfect condition, appearing unused and retaining its full, dense pile. The natural variations in the wool contribute to its authentic character, with no visible signs of wear or damage.
